Engineered FRP Pultruded Grating for Heavy-Duty Industrial Environments

FRP pultruded grating is manufactured using a continuous pultrusion process where E-CR glass fibers are impregnated with premium resin and drawn through a heated die to form high-strength, uniform cross-section bars. These bars are then assembled into a rigid grating panel using through-rod connections, creating a bearing bar system that delivers exceptional load-bearing performance.

Unlike molded grating, pultruded grating features unidirectional glass fiber orientation in the bearing bars, resulting in significantly higher strength in the load direction — up to 1000 psf capacity. This makes it the preferred choice for heavy industrial applications such as offshore platforms, chemical plants, power generation facilities, and mining operations where maximum strength and durability are required.

Available in multiple material grades including I-600 (standard), I-650 (fire retardant), and I-685 (corrosion-resistant vinyl ester). All panels feature a grit-embedded anti-slip surface and are available with I-bar, T-bar, or C-profile bearing bars. Custom panel widths, lengths, cutouts, and colors available to match your exact project specifications.

Parameter Value
Material E-CR Glass Fiber + Isophthalic Polyester / Vinyl Ester Resin
Bearing Bar Profile I-bar, T-bar, C-channel, Flat bar
Standard Panel Size 1220mm × 6100mm (4ft × 20ft) max
Bearing Bar Depth 25mm (1"), 38mm (1.5"), 50mm (2"), 64mm (2.5")
Bar Spacing 30mm, 38mm, 50mm center-to-center
Load Capacity Up to 1000 psf (48 kN/m²) depending on bar depth and spacing
Resin Grades I-600 (Standard), I-650 (Fire Retardant), I-685 (Vinyl Ester)
Glass Content 65% - 75% glass fiber by weight (unidirectional)

Highest Load Capacity in Its Class

Unidirectional glass fiber orientation delivers up to 1000 psf load capacity — the highest of any FRP grating type. Ideal for heavy vehicular traffic and equipment platforms.

Extended Span Capability

Pultruded bearing bars can span up to 20ft (6m) without intermediate supports, reducing substructure costs and installation time.

Superior Corrosion & Chemical Resistance

Vinyl ester resin options provide exceptional resistance to strong acids, bleaches, and aggressive chemicals. Outperforms stainless steel in many corrosive environments.

Modular Design & Easy Installation

Lightweight panels with predrilled mounting holes and integrated clip systems enable rapid installation without specialized equipment or welding.

Slip-Resistant Safety Surface

Embedded silica grit top surface provides reliable slip resistance (COF > 0.85) meeting OSHA, ANSI, and international safety standards for walkway applications.

Non-Conductive & Spark-Proof

Electrically non-conductive and non-sparking, making it the safest flooring solution for electrical rooms, transformer stations, and explosive environments.
